For the serious collector of Cuban tobacco, few concepts generate as much excitement as the Regional Edition program. These releases offer a unique window into the partnership between Habanos and specific global distributors, resulting in cigars that are otherwise absent from standard production lines. A prime example of this exclusivity is the Por Larrañaga Sobresalientes, a cigar that was launched in 2014 with a singular purpose: to satisfy the discerning palates of the British market. This release stands as a testament to the historic Por Larrañaga brand, providing a distinctive vitola that enriches the portfolio of any enthusiast fortunate enough to secure a box.

The Exclusivity of the Regional Edition Program

The Edición Regional initiative allows distributors from various territories to commission unique sizes from established brands, creating bespoke products for their local clientele. The Sobresalientes was the designated release for Great Britain in 2014, a move that highlighted the specific demands of the UK cigar scene. By introducing a vitola that was previously unavailable in the regular portfolio, the program ensured that British aficionados had access to a shape and blend configuration tailored specifically for them. This strategy not only fosters brand loyalty but also creates a chase for international collectors who seek out these market-specific gems.
Technical Specifications and Construction
From a structural perspective, the Sobresalientes is a commanding cigar that promises a substantial smoking experience. It is entirely handmade, a hallmark of the brand’s dedication to quality craftsmanship. The dimensions suggest a smoke that allows for the evolution of flavor profiles over a significant period.
- Factory Name: Sobresalientes
- Dimensions: The cigar measures 153 mm (approximately 6 inches) in length.
- Ring Gauge: A robust 53, offering a comfortable draw and ample filler.
- Official Weight: 15.00 grams
This combination of length and girth places the cigar firmly in the category of a grand smoke, suitable for long contemplation. The construction reflects the brand's historic reputation for consistency, ensuring that the physical attributes match the premium nature of the tobacco inside.
Packaging and Visual Identity

The presentation of the Por Larrañaga Sobresalientes is designed to communicate its rarity immediately. The cigars are housed in semi boîte nature boxes, each containing 10 units. The production was strictly capped at 5,000 boxes, a limitation that guarantees scarcity and drives demand among collectors. Each box is individually numbered, adding an element of verification and exclusivity to the purchase.
Visually, the cigar distinguishes itself through a dual-band configuration. While it wears the traditional Por Larrañaga livery, it is also adorned with a secondary band that explicitly denotes its status as an Edición Regional for Gran Bretaña. This additional marking serves as an immediate identifier, signaling to the smoker that this is not a standard production run, but rather a special creation for the British Isles.
